kwave  18.07.70
MP3Encoder.cpp File Reference
#include "config.h"
#include <math.h>
#include <id3/globals.h>
#include <id3/misc_support.h>
#include <id3/tag.h>
#include <QByteArray>
#include <QDate>
#include <QDateTime>
#include <QLatin1Char>
#include <QList>
#include <QMap>
#include <KLocalizedString>
#include "libkwave/FileInfo.h"
#include "libkwave/GenreType.h"
#include "libkwave/MessageBox.h"
#include "libkwave/MetaDataList.h"
#include "libkwave/MixerMatrix.h"
#include "libkwave/MultiTrackReader.h"
#include "libkwave/Sample.h"
#include "libkwave/SampleReader.h"
#include "libkwave/String.h"
#include "libkwave/Utils.h"
#include "ID3_QIODeviceWriter.h"
#include "MP3CodecPlugin.h"
#include "MP3Encoder.h"
#include "MP3EncoderSettings.h"
Include dependency graph for MP3Encoder.cpp:

Go to the source code of this file.

Macros

#define OPTION(__field__)   if (settings.__field__.length()) m_params.append(settings.__field__)
 
#define OPTION_P(__field__, __value__)
 

Macro Definition Documentation

◆ OPTION

#define OPTION (   __field__)    if (settings.__field__.length()) m_params.append(settings.__field__)

Definition at line 256 of file MP3Encoder.cpp.

Referenced by Kwave::MP3Encoder::encode().

◆ OPTION_P

#define OPTION_P (   __field__,
  __value__ 
)
Value:
if (settings.__field__.length()) \
m_params.append( \
QString(settings.__field__.arg(__value__)).split(QLatin1Char(' ')))

Definition at line 259 of file MP3Encoder.cpp.

Referenced by Kwave::MP3Encoder::encode().